Join Our Team of Expert Tutors – QTS Required | Flexible, Rewarding, Impactful
Are you a qualified teacher seeking a flexible and fulfilling role beyond the classroom? We’re looking for passionate, experienced tutors with QTS to support students across Enfield.
Whether part-time, full-time, online, or in-person — we have opportunities that work for you.
Deliver 1:1 or small group sessions in your specialist subject
Support with exam prep, revision, and coursework
Track and report progress and engagement
Communicate with parents, schools, and TP Tutors
Prioritise student well-being and safeguarding
Deliver sessions online or face-to-face
English, Maths, Science (KS2–KS5)
Humanities, Languages, and Primary welcomed
SEN/SEMH experience highly valued
Teaching/tutoring experience with school-aged learners
Able to adapt to different abilities and learning styles
Strong communication and behaviour management skills
Enhanced DBS on the Update Service (or willing to apply)
Pay: £25–£30/hr (PAYE), paid weekly
Flexible hours – you choose your schedule
Local and remote tutoring opportunities
Access to CPD via our Tutor Academy
Support from a Specialist Consultant
Pension Scheme + Refer a Friend bonus
